      Meaning of the first name
      Odie

      Origin 
      American

      Meaning 
      Oddball

      Variations 
      Odierne, Bodie, Codie

      Based on our records...
      This is the most common surname, spouse name and child name associated with Odie.
      Smith

      is the most common surname for Odie.

      John

      is the most common spouse name for Odie.

      Odie

      is the most common child name for Odie.

      Did you know?
      1907 is when there were the most people born with the first name Odie.
